The Apple Iced Tea is a refreshing and fruity cocktail that blends the crisp flavors of apple with the tangy zest of lemon-lime soda. Served in a highball glass, this drink combines the smooth strength of vodka, the subtle sweetness of white rum, and the botanical notes of gin, creating a well-rounded base.
The apple juice and apple schnapps amplify the orchard-fresh taste, making it fit for a balmy afternoon or as a relaxing evening sipper. Its effervescence and mellow sweetness make it an approachable choice for those who enjoy a spirited but not overpowering mix in their cocktail experience.

How to make a Apple Iced Tea
- Vodka 15ml, White rum 15ml, Gin 15ml, Apple schnapps 15ml, Lemon-Lime soda Top up, Apple Juice 45ml
-
- Add all the ingredients (except the Sprite) to a highball glass with ice
-
- Top up with the Sprite as required
-
- Stir and serve

How do I properly stir the Apple Iced Tea cocktail to ensure the best flavor?
To properly stir the Apple Iced Tea cocktail, fill your highball glass with ice, add all the liquid ingredients except the lemon-lime soda first. Use a long spoon to stir the mix gently but thoroughly for about 30 seconds. This ensures the ingredients are well combined without diluting the drink too much. Top up with lemon-lime soda last and give it a final gentle stir to integrate the soda without losing its fizz.
What is the best way to serve an Apple Iced Tea cocktail to enhance its presentation?
The best way to serve an Apple Iced Tea cocktail is in a highball glass filled with ice, ensuring it's cold. Garnish with a thin apple slice or a wedge on the rim of the glass and perhaps a sprig of mint for a pop of color. The garnishing will not only enhance its presentation but also subtly complement the apple flavor of the drink.
Can I substitute another type of juice for apple juice in an Apple Iced Tea?
Yes, you can substitute another type of juice for apple juice in an Apple Iced Tea. Pear juice or white grape juice makes a good substitute, maintaining a similar sweetness and fruity profile. However, keep in mind that substituting the juice will alter the flavor profile of the cocktail.
How does the alcohol content of Apple Iced Tea compare to that of a typical beer?
The alcohol content of Apple Iced Tea is 6.75%, which roughly aligns with or is slightly higher than many craft beers, but it's higher than most standard lagers, which typically have an alcohol content around 4-5%. This makes the Apple Iced Tea comparable in alcohol strength to stronger beers or light cocktails.
What is a good non-alcoholic variation of the Apple Iced Tea?
A good non-alcoholic variation of the Apple Iced Tea would involve eliminating the vodka, white rum, gin, and apple schnapps from the recipe. Replace these with a mix of apple juice, a splash of lemon or lime juice for some tang, and a non-alcoholic ginger beer or sparkling apple cider to top up, which gives it a fizzy kick. This variation keeps the refreshing essence of the cocktail while making it suitable for all ages.
